QUETTA, April 25: Five bullet-riddled bodies were found in Khuzdar and Turbat districts on Monday.

Sources said that residents of Zedi locality in Khuzdar informed the police about the presence of three bodies in their area. Police shifted the bodies to Civil Hospital, Khuzdar. The bodies were identified as those of Mohammad Ayub Mohammad Hasni, Ghulam Murtaza Zehri and Hafiz Bajo.

“All victims had bullet wounds on their bodies,” hospital sources said.

Two bodies were found in Manghab area of Turbat. Identified as Mohammad Zareef and Sanaullah, the dead had bullet wounds on their chest and heads.

Levies Force personnel took the bodies to Turbat district hospital.

Levies sources said that the two men had been missing for the last one week.

The bodies were handed over to the families.
